Output 8259edf24c6d9050320ec09ea5d9d925c35c0e25c53dccd8dac2c35bfa0fef89:5

value
806332
script pubkey
OP_0 OP_PUSHBYTES_20 0254580c7bb04f6f915ac021e2e996a235d71e40
address
bc1qqf29srrmkp8kly26cqs796vk5g6aw8jqupyrp3
transaction
8259edf24c6d9050320ec09ea5d9d925c35c0e25c53dccd8dac2c35bfa0fef89